The 4th Annual ShibariCon will take place in the Chicago area from May 25-28, 2007. 

image

ShibariCon is the world’s premier annual exhibition and conference that focuses on education and information exchange among lovers of Japanese rope bondage. The goal of ShibarCon is simple; to provide an inclusive and supportive environment for the exchange of ideas, education, friendship and community. Since its inception in 2004, ShibariCon has become a treasured retreat where rope lovers from all over the world come together to live in the moment as part of a supporive community, learn new skills, and experience the joy of using those new skills to enhance relationships, both new and old.

ShibariCon is produced by lovers of rope, for lovers of rope. We welcome you to join us to experience the magic created when so many rope lovers come together. Seduced: Art And Sex From Antiquity To Now at the Barbican in London from 12-October-2007 to 27-January-2008.

image

Above: Aubrey Beardsley’s ”Cinesias Entreating Myrrhina to Coition”, Illustration from Lysistrata by Aristophanes 1896

“Seduced: Art and Sex from Antiquity to Now” is a major exhibition focusing on representations of sex from diverse eras and cultures. Provocative and ambitious, it includes around 250 works, spanning over 2000 years, including Roman marbles, Indian manuscripts, Renaissance and Baroque paintings and sculptures, Chinese paintings and prints, Japanese woodcuts, 19th century photographs and contemporary video. Drawn from important public and private collections from around the world; some of the works have never been seen in public, others rarely shown and many have never been exhibited in the UK . Seduced opens at Barbican Art Gallery on 12 October 2007.

Curated by scholars Marina Wallace, Martin Kemp and Joanne Bernstein, Seduced aims to generate a lively public debate about shifting attitudes towards explicit imagery, and to question the lines drawn between art and pornography.

As the curators say, “We are all here because of a sexual act…The union of two bodies is an act of extraordinary physical and emotional intimacy. The prelude, the process of seduction, the act itself and the immediate aftermath provide the focus for the exhibition. Like the preening bird, evolutionary rituals dominate the way we behave before, during and after sex. But as humans, we have developed elaborate social frameworks for its expression and its regulation. Visual representations of the sexual act have played key roles in the culture of sex, ranging from open display to absolute censorship.”

Over 70 artists are featured including Francis Bacon, Louise Bourgeois, Annibale Carracci, Jean Honore Fragonard, Guercino, Jeff Koons, Robert Mapplethorpe, Pablo Picasso, Auguste Rodin, Egon Schiele, Bartholomeus Spranger, J M W Turner, Kitagawa Utamaro and Andy Warhol.

It reveals how works of art with a sexual content have been openly displayed, concealed or forbidden over time. In ancient Greece, very explicit images of heterosexual and homosexual sex were rife and yet these same images have been typically downplayed in the antiquarian context of museums. The great English landscape painter, Turner, made secret sketches of sexual activities in his private notebooks, whilst Emperor Rudolph II at Prague openly commissioned flamboyant oil paintings of the loves of the gods for his gallery. Japanese prints, issued in very large numbers, treated sex with a directness that is extraordinary by any standards.

Presenting a powerful sensory experience, the exhibition highlights the relationship between viewer and artwork and provides the historical and cultural framework for us to question our own boundaries; where does art stop and pornography begin? Is an explicit painting from an ancient Pompeian brothel acceptable (hallowed by time), while its modern equivalent is not?...Because something can claim “aesthetic merit” can it be exempted from charges of obscenity?

The exhibition is enhanced by sound and movement. A sound installation entitled The Voice of Sex features readings from erotic texts, such as the Kama Sutra, Lolita and late 18th century books by the Marquis de Sade. Whilst on selected dates, Union Dance , under the artistic direction of Corrine Bougaard, present a specially commissioned movement series created as an integral part of the exhibition concept, with music specially composed by Hayden Chisholm.
